什么是SRAM
- SRAM是Static Random Access Memory的缩写,即静态随机存取存储器。它是一种常用的计算机内存类型,与DRAM(动态随机存取存储器)相对。SRAM使用晶体管存储数据,具有速度快、功耗低、读写速度快等优点,但容量较小且成本较高。它通常用于CPU缓存和高速缓冲存储器中,以加快数据处理速度。
